So a few months back I posted a thread on a forum asking if it was possible to breed tonga nassarius snails, because I found mine had some eggs on the glass, I was eager and curious.
A few "local" experts on the forum explained that even though they are laying eggs, which they will regularly, perhaps 1 out of thousands may survive!

Terrible odds I thought, ok well just don't worry about it then

so tonight Im about to go to sleep, and I decide to take a peek in my tank to see what could be lurking in the dark (its only a 20G but you never know)

I look in to see a few random little snails on the glass, then I take a closer look, They resemble tonga super nassarius snails! No way! I couldn't believe what I was seeing!

It gets better...

I decide that perhaps they are maybe a random hitch hiker, that I cant get too excited, so I throw some hermit crab pellets into the tank... that was when they came out...

In 10 mins I saw about about 200 - 2mm tonga nassarius snails crawl out from sand and head straight towards the pellets.

Not only was it improbable that they could survive... but they are thriving!!!! I had to tell someone!

I also had some that layed eggs about 2.5 months ago and then sure enough i saw the little babys with there pokie things all over the glass and sand. I would say i have about 30 babies i guess..As soon as i feed the tank they all come out of the sand...In 2 months they are now about 1/2 inch i guess.....I only started with 4 of them as we'll.
